Elon Musk has publicly addressed accusations of racism by citing his partner, Shivon Zilis, who is of half-Indian descent. The statement serves as a personal rebuttal to ongoing criticism regarding his public conduct and corporate culture.
Contextualizing Elon Musk's Response to Racism Allegations
Elon Musk has recently utilized his personal life as a focal point to counter mounting allegations of racism. By explicitly identifying his partner, Shivon Zilis, as being half-Indian and raised in Canada, Musk is attempting to contextualize his personal associations as evidence against accusations that he harbors discriminatory views. This defensive maneuver highlights the increasing pressure public figures face when their personal conduct is scrutinized against their corporate and social reputations.

Broader Implications of Corporate Leadership Conduct
These allegations of racism against Musk do not exist in a vacuum; they occur within the broader context of intense scrutiny surrounding his leadership at companies like Tesla, SpaceX, and X (formerly Twitter). Critics often point to allegations of workplace discrimination within his organizations as a reflection of his personal values. By bringing his partner into the conversation, Musk is attempting to create a firewall between his corporate leadership style and his private life, suggesting that his personal commitments are inconsistent with the characterizations presented by his detractors.
